Installs and calibrates meters, maintains meter-testing schedule, insures all measurement test schedules are performed;
Performs gas sample analysis, dew point analysis and H2S sampling analysis;
Installs and maintains over pressure protection equipment;
Installs and calibrates end devices such as pressure transducers, temperature transmitters and valve positioners;
Installs and maintains H2S analyzers, moisture analyzers, gas chromatographs, oxygen sensors, serial communication devices and connections;
Installs and maintains batteries, solar panels, thermal electric generators and batter charge controllers;
Maintains calibration and gas sampling equipment; and
May perform other duties in another classification, as directed.
